Gas SUVs: A Familiar Choice With Broad Flexibility

Gas-powered SUVs remain practical for drivers who value quick refueling, wide availability, and simple planning on long trips. They can be a comfortable choice for households without reliable charging, people who travel through remote areas, and drivers whose schedules change often. Gas models are also widely available across compact, midsize, three-row, off-road, and towing-focused SUV categories.

The advantages are straightforward:

  • Fuel stations are easy to find in most areas.
  • Long highway trips usually require fewer planning decisions.
  • Many models have lower starting prices than similar electrified options.
  • Drivers can choose from a broad range of engines, drivetrains, and capability levels.

The trade-off is fuel consumption, particularly in stop-and-go traffic. Gas prices also change, so it is smart to estimate annual fuel spending based on realistic mileage rather than one week of driving. A gas SUV may still be the most sensible choice when flexibility, towing ability, or easy refueling matter more than maximizing efficiency.

Hybrid SUVs: Better Efficiency Without A Plug

Standard hybrid SUVs pair a gasoline engine with an electric motor and battery system. They do not need to be plugged in because the vehicle recaptures some energy while slowing down and braking. That process, called regenerative braking, can make hybrids especially useful for commuters, parents running errands, and drivers who regularly face congested traffic.

For many buyers, a hybrid is the middle ground. It feels familiar because refueling happens at a gas station, yet it can use less fuel during lower-speed driving than a comparable gas-only SUV. The savings may be less dramatic for drivers who spend nearly all of their time at steady highway speeds, but hybrids can still offer a practical balance of convenience and efficiency.

Electric SUVs: A Strong Fit For Certain Driving Patterns

Electric SUVs offer quiet operation, immediate acceleration, and the convenience of charging where the vehicle is parked. For someone with a garage, driveway, or dependable workplace charger, starting each morning with a charged battery can be easier than making regular fuel stops. Electric ownership tends to work best when daily travel is predictable, and charging is part of the normal routine.

Charging access deserves the same attention as cargo space or rear-seat comfort. The Department of Energy explains that driving needs, charging options, and longer-trip planning help determine whether an EV is a good fit. Review home electrical capacity, apartment or condo rules, workplace access, public charging locations, connector compatibility, and the routes you use most often.

Compare Total Ownership Costs

A monthly payment is important, but it does not show the complete financial picture. Compare each SUV over three or five years using your expected mileage, not an optimistic estimate. A driver covering 20,000 miles annually may see very different operating costs than one driving 7,000 miles a year.

  1. Purchase price, lease payment, and financing costs
  2. Fuel or electricity expenses
  3. Insurance premiums, registration, and taxes
  4. Routine maintenance, tires, brakes, and fluids
  5. Home charging equipment and installation, if needed
  6. Warranty coverage and expected resale value

Electric models generally have fewer engine-related service items, while gas and hybrid SUVs still need oil-related service and other scheduled maintenance. However, tire wear, insurance costs, repair availability, and charging installation can also affect the final number. The best value is not always the SUV with the lowest sticker price or the lowest advertised payment.

Think About Weather, Terrain, And Cargo

Every powertrain is affected by real-world conditions. Cold weather, steep terrain, high speeds, roof boxes, heavy cargo, and towing increase energy use. The electric range can change noticeably during winter driving or when cabin heating is used heavily. Gas and hybrid SUVs also consume more fuel when hauling passengers, equipment, or trailers.

Check Efficiency And Emissions Ratings Carefully

Compare vehicles in similar size and capability classes. Fuel economy for gas and hybrid SUVs is usually measured in miles per gallon, while EV efficiency is commonly shown in miles per gallon equivalent and kilowatt-hours used over a set distance. Ratings are useful starting points, but weather, driving speed, cargo, and terrain will influence what you experience.

Electric SUVs have no tailpipe emissions, but a complete environmental comparison also considers the energy used to produce and deliver fuel or electricity. The EPA tool that estimates annual greenhouse gas emissions from mileage and fuel economy can help buyers put their own driving habits into context.

A Simple Five-Step Buying Process

1. Record A Typical Week

Track daily miles, traffic, passenger needs, overnight parking, and the longest trips you usually make each month.

2. Identify Fuel Or Charging Access

Confirm whether home charging is realistic. If it is not, investigate workplace and public charging before choosing an electric SUV.

3. Set A Real Ownership Budget

Include energy, insurance, maintenance, tires, taxes, registration, and potential charging costs.

4. Compare Similar Vehicles

Match SUVs by size, cargo room, drivetrain, safety features, and warranty coverage for a fair comparison.

5. Test The Daily Details

Pay attention to visibility, parking ease, rear-seat space, cargo access, ride comfort, and technology during a test drive.
